Merethrond, also known as the Great Hall of Feasts, was a large, vaulted chamber with an arched roof found in Minas Tirith used by the nobility of Gondor for feasting. It was north of the White Tower of Minas Tirith in the High Court.

Aragorn met with Éomer at this place once the War of the Ring ended.

Etymology

Merethrond is Sindarin for 'Hall of Feasts'.

In adaptations

In The Lord of the Rings Online, Merethrond is present in all three main versions of Minas Tirith but is the most prominent during Midsummer when it hosts the Banquet after the royal wedding of Aragorn and Arwen.
